ETFFIN Finance >> Kursus keuangan >  >> Cryptocurrency >> Blockchain

10 Alat Pengembangan Ethereum Teratas Pada Tahun 2021

10 alat pengembangan Ethereum teratas pada tahun 2021 dengan elemen inti mereka dan kemungkinan alternatif pengganti

Alat pengembangan Ethereum adalah salah satu opsi terbaik untuk mengembangkan dApps atau kontrak pintar. Pengembangan kontrak pintar atau dApps tidak terbatas pada pengkodean dan penerapan. Seseorang akan membutuhkan API, jaringan percobaan, alat debugging yang dapat diandalkan, dan banyak lagi.

Dunia pengembangan blockchain berubah dengan kecepatan peluru. Dalam fenomena teknologi yang terus berubah ini, Anda mungkin telah melihat munculnya alat pengembangan Ethereum baru. Berikut adalah 10 alat pengembangan Ethereum teratas untuk membuat Anda terus diperbarui dan di atas permainan Anda:

Truffle

Truffle adalah kerangka kerja pengembangan dan penerapan dan salah satu alat Pengembangan Ethereum terbaik untuk membuat dan menyampaikan aplikasi Ethereum. Dalam bahasa awam, Anda bisa membuat usaha, kode dan atur kontrak pintar, menjalankan tes robot, pindah, dan antarmuka dengan perjanjian. Sepanjang garis ini, Truffle menawarkan ekosistem lengkap untuk upaya kemajuan dApp Anda.

MetaMask

MetaMask telah memperoleh banyak pijakan di antara klien dalam beberapa tahun. Kemudahan dan kenyamanan adalah dua kolom yang menjadikannya salah satu alat pengembangan Ethereum yang paling terkenal. MetaMask adalah dompet Ethereum dan pintu aplikasi blockchain yang berfungsi sebagai augmentasi browser internet. Itu berarti, semua orang dapat menyertakan peningkatan kecil yang bermanfaat ini dari PC atau program portabel mereka, termasuk — Chrome, Firefox, Opera, Berani, dan lain-lain.

ganache

Sehubungan dengan pengujian Ethereum dApp, hanya beberapa alat pengembangan Ethereum yang benar-benar mendekati kegunaan Ganache. Ganache memberi Anda blockchain pribadi untuk dijalankan di gadget terdekat yang dapat Anda gunakan sepanjang siklus peningkatan. Ini membantu dalam menciptakan, tes, dan sampaikan kontrak pintar Ethereum Anda dalam iklim yang lebih aman. Jadi, Anda dapat mengubah atau menyelidiki masalah apa pun tanpa mengaitkannya dengan testnet atau mainnet yang terbuka.

Remix IDE

Jika Anda mencari perangkat kompilasi dan debugging yang kuat untuk kemajuan kontrak pintar, Remix IDE adalah salah satu alat pengembangan Ethereum yang paling menakjubkan untuk Anda. Remix IDE adalah kompiler berbasis JavaScript open-source yang memungkinkan Anda membuat kode langsung dari browser internet Anda. Ini memiliki aplikasi desktop yang berbeda apalagi.

PEMBAGIAN BITCOIN DAN BLOCKCHAIN:BAGAIMANA DAMPAKNYA SKENARIO DUNIA NYATA?

5 KETERAMPILAN TOP YANG HARUS DIMILIKI PENGEMBANG BLOCKCHAIN

CRYPTOCURRENCIES TOP MENGGUNAKAN BLOCKCHAIN ​​NODE SEBAGAI FUNGSIONALITAS INTI

Getha

Geth adalah pelanggan CLI untuk melaksanakan Go Ethereum sebagai konvensi blockchain. Pada dasarnya, itu adalah antarmuka baris pesanan yang dapat berjalan sebagai simpul penuh, simpul dokumen, atau simpul cahaya. Geth mengisi sebagai dompet untuk menyimpan Eter, melakukan pertukaran, kirim kontrak pintar, dll. Bagaimanapun, Geth berubah menjadi pilihan yang lebih baik dianalisis daripada Mist, karena itu juga dapat menambang Eter dan mengisi sebagai pintu masuk ke jaringan Ethereum melalui titik akhir JSON RPC melalui HTTP.

Keseimbangan

Sangat mirip dengan Getah, Parity adalah salah satu alat pengembangan Ethereum yang paling terkenal dan kedua perangkat ini memenuhi kebutuhan yang sama — pelanggan Ethereum. Kontras utama antara Geth dan Paritas adalah bahwa Paritas ditulis dalam Rust. Meskipun sulit untuk melihat go dan rust, karena keduanya adalah bahasa yang luar biasa, Karat sedikit di depan karena memori papan dan lebih baik. Jadi, Paritas secara bawaan lebih cepat dari Geth.

Eter.js

Ethers.js adalah salah satu lingkungan perpustakaan Ethereum paling lengkap dan tereduksi, menjadikannya salah satu alat pengembangan Ethereum yang paling terkenal. Pertama, eters.js ditujukan untuk eters.io — dompet dan program dApp. Tapi seiring waktu, perpustakaan telah diperluas secara luas dan saat ini digunakan sebagai perpustakaan Ethereum yang berguna secara universal.

infura

Infura adalah akses API untuk jaringan Ethereum dan IPFS. Seperti yang kemungkinan besar Anda sadari, aplikasi apa pun yang terkait dengan server menggunakan API yang berfungsi sebagai delegasi antara aplikasi dan pekerja. Karena kami menggunakan Web 3.0 dengan aplikasi Ethereum, setiap orang membutuhkan variasi API lainnya.

Memulai

Embark adalah sistem pengembangan Ethereum yang luar biasa lainnya dan salah satu alat pengembangan Ethereum yang paling menonjol. Ini menggabungkan blockchain Ethereum (EVM), kerangka kerja kapasitas terdesentralisasi (IPFS), dan platform korespondensi.

Dengan Memulai, Anda dapat secara otomatis mengirim perjanjian ke testnet, jaring pribadi, atau jaringan utama. Ini juga memantau perjanjian Anda dan secara alami menerapkan kembali kontrak pintar dan dApps sesuai dengan perubahan Anda. Lebih-lebih lagi, terbaik dari semuanya, Anda dapat mendorong perjanjian dengan JavaScript.

Gerimis

Gerimis adalah alat ketiga dan terakhir di TruffleSuite. Truffle dan Ganache pada dasarnya digunakan untuk pengembangan dan pengujian, terpisah. Gerimis menawarkan bermacam-macam perpustakaan front-end yang menyelesaikan kebutuhan kemajuan umum dengan TruffleSuite. Dukungan front-end ini membuat peningkatan dApp jauh lebih bermanfaat dan dapat diprediksi.

Kesimpulannya, ini adalah 10 alat pengembangan Ethereum teratas pada tahun 2021. Selain sepuluh ini, ada alat lain seperti dAppBoard, web3.js, Ethlint (Solium), sol, dan OpenZeppelin yang akan membantu Anda sepanjang perjalanan pengembangan aplikasi Ethereum.